SUMMARY OF THE MINUTES OF THE 322nd BOARD OF DIRECTORS’ MEETING

HELD ON MAY 31, 2017

 

1.         DATE, TIME AND VENUE: The meeting was held at 9:00 a.m. on May 31, 2017, at the registered office of Companhia Paulista de Força e Luz, located at Rodovia Engenheiro Miguel Noel Nascentes Burnier, nº 1755, Km 2,5, in the city of Campinas, state of São Paulo.

 

2.         CALL NOTICE: The meeting was called pursuant to Paragraph 2, Article 17 of the Bylaws of CPFL Energia S.A. ("CPFL Energia" or "Company").

 

3.         ATTENDANCE: All the members of the Board of Directors (“Board”), with the written votes of Mr. Yuhai Hu, Mr. Yang Qu and Mr. Yumeng Zhao cast in advance, pursuant to Paragraph 7, Article 17 of the Company’s Bylaws.

 

4.         PRESIDING BOARD: Mr. Andre Dorf, Chairman, and Mr. Gustavo Sablewski, Secretary.

 

5.         MATTERS DISCUSSED AND RESOLUTIONS TAKEN BY UNANIMOUS VOTE:

 

The reading of the Agenda was waived as all those present were aware of its contents. The directors also resolved to draw up these minutes in summary form, with the right to submit opinions and dissensions, which will be filed at the headquarters of the Company, and to publish them as an extract of the decisions without their signatures. After discussing and examining the items on the Agenda, the directors, with due abstentions from voting, unanimously decided as follows:

(x) To approve (i) the provision of guarantee in the amount of five hundred and fifty million reais (R$550,000,000.00) in the form of suretyship or guarantee, to raise funds at the subsidiary RGE Sul; and (ii) to recommend to their representatives in the Board of Directors of RGE Sul to consider and vote, and possibly approve, the raising of funds through loans based on Federal Law 4,131/62, with a swap to CDI rate, and the offering of said swap as guarantee, Rural Credit, Bank Credit Note, promissory notes with take out of long-term debt, issues of debentures or other working capital facilities in the amount of up to five hundred and fifty million reais (R$550,000,000.00) or an equivalent amount in foreign currency, with maturity in up to 5 years, quarterly, semiannual or annual interest payments, pursuant to Resolution 2017042-E of the Board of Executive Officers;

 

(xi) To approve the offering of guarantee through suretyship or guarantee in the amount of up to two hundred million reais (R$ 200,000,000.00) to BNDES and NIB, to guarantee the financing agreement of Bons Ventos, a subsidiary of CPFL Renováveis, which  will be responsible for paying a commission of two point five percent (2.5%) over the contract value, pursuant to Resolution 2017043-E of the Board of Executive Officers.
